DJ International Paper Co. Stock Underperforms Monday When Compared To Competitors
This article was automatically generated by MarketWatch using technology from Automated Insights.
Shares of International Paper Co. $(IP)$ shed 2.88% to $38.39 Monday, on what proved to be an all-around positive trading session for the stock market, with the S&P 500 Index rising 0.83% to 6,795.99 and the Dow Jones Industrial Average rising 0.50% to 47,740.80.
This was the stock's third consecutive day of losses.
International Paper Co. closed 32.22% below its 52-week high of $56.64, which the company reached on March 25th.
The stock underperformed when compared to some of its competitors Monday, as Weyerhaeuser Co. $(WY)$ fell 0.20% to $24.45.
Trading volume (10.3 M) eclipsed its 50-day average volume of 6.7 M.
